It was Player of the Year night at the Riverside for Boro Supporters Club 2020 last night.
Held over from last season - Jonny Howson was Player of the Year and Isaiah Jones Young Player of the Year. Both were overwhelming first choices in the supporters club polls held for season 2021-2022.
Jonny Howson posed for pics and signed autographs for the room full of supporters who all queued patiently before the pies and peas were served up. The award was presented by Joanne Bolton in memory of her husband and long time secretary of the former Official Supporters Club, the late Simon Bolton.
Jonny gamely answered questions set from host Gary Philipson as well as supporters. Firstly Jonny said how the empty stadiums during covid had underlined that football is nothing without the fans. It was really interesting to hear the match plan from the opposition camp when Norwich broke our hearts at Wembley in the play off final. First goal will be the winner was the Norwich outlook and so all about getting quickly out of the blocks. This approach wasn't harmed by Boro's late arrival, something not lost on the Canaries.
I was the last of the eleven raffle prize winners. Top prize was a match-worn Patrick Bamford Boro shirt - real value in that. I won a really nice commemorative Jack Charlton booklet put together for a recent player reunion by the late Peter Hodgson.
